Comment (by adamfowleruk):

 Here's a thread that references the issue. I can confirm the keyboard
 worked OOTB in Linux Mint, but the trackpad required the 4.19 kernel.

 I think now actually the keyboard was a PS/2 derivative, and the trackpad
 was the I2C device. It's just the keyboard LIGHTING that's a WMI device.
 That may well make it simpler.
